Ceph和Gluster:开源存储方案的巅峰之作

随着数据量的不断增长,企业对存储解决方案的需求也变得越来越迫切。在这个数字化时代,数据是企业的核心资产,因此安全、高效、可扩展的存储系统变得至关重要。在众多存储技术中,Ceph和Gluster无疑是备受瞩目的开源存储方案。本文将重点探讨Ceph和Gluster这两个存储方案的特点以及适用场景。

Ceph是一种分布式文件系统和对象存储解决方案,其目标是提供可扩展的、高性能的存储解决方案。Ceph采用了一种称为CRUSH算法的独特数据分布算法,通过智能数据分布和数据冗余机制实现高可靠性和高可用性。Ceph还具有强大的可扩展性,可根据需求自动增加存储节点,从而满足数据的不断增长。此外,Ceph还支持多种接口和协议,包括块存储、文件系统和对象存储,使其适用于各种不同的应用场景。

与Ceph不同,Gluster是一种分布式文件系统,旨在提供一个统一的命名空间,使多台服务器的存储资源可以集中管理。Gluster使用“存储池”和“卷”来组织和管理存储资源,通过将数据和元数据均匀地分布在各个存储节点上实现存储的可扩展性和高可用性。Gluster还支持多种协议,包括NFS、CIFS和HDFS等,使其具备广泛的应用场景。

Ceph和Gluster都是开源存储方案,它们有许多共同之处,例如均支持可扩展性和高可用性,具备强大的数据冗余和恢复机制,以及对多种接口和协议的支持。然而,它们也存在一些差异。首先,Ceph采用了对象存储的方式来组织和管理数据,而Gluster则采用了文件系统的方式。其次,Ceph更适合于需要高性能和大规模存储的应用场景,而Gluster则更适合于需要高可靠性和易于管理的应用场景。最后,Ceph的部署和配置相对较复杂,需要一定的技术水平,而Gluster则相对简单,适合初学者使用。

对于企业来说,选择Ceph或Gluster作为存储解决方案取决于具体的需求和情况。如果企业需要一个高性能的存储系统,能够满足大规模数据存储和处理的需求,那么Ceph是一个不错的选择。Ceph能够提供可靠的数据冗余和高可用性,同时也具备优秀的扩展性和灵活性。然而,如果企业更关注存储系统的易用性和管理性,以及对多种协议的支持,那么Gluster可能更适合他们的需求。Gluster能够简化存储资源的管理,并且具备良好的兼容性。

总之,无论是Ceph还是Gluster,它们都是开源存储方案中的佼佼者。Ceph以其强大的性能和灵活的架构在大规模数据存储和处理方面表现出色,而Gluster则以其易用性和兼容性在企业市场上获得广泛认可。选择适合自己的存储方案,是企业在数字化时代中不可忽视的决策之一。希望本文能够帮助读者更好地理解Ceph和Gluster的特点以及适用场景,并在实际应用中发挥其最大的优势。